I just successfully replaced my broken odometer gear with IPD's kit. It was really easy to do! One of you guys already told me that you can extract the real mileage of the car from the ECU through the DTC socket A7. I was able to get the mileage but I checked it after driving the car for a few miles and it spit out the exact same mileage as it did the first time. I know it should be a few miles higher. Does the ECU record the mileage in real-time or does it update the miles on a regular cycle? Thanks for all of your extremely valuable knowledge!!
